Rent Movies

 

Instead of buying a movie on DVD or going to the movie theatre to see a new movie, wait until it's out on video in your local video store and rent it. Renting a video costs about 1/5th of the cost of buying it and if we are honest with ourselves, we seldom watch movies that we buy more than once. Watching the movie at a theatre is the most expensive way to see a movie. By the time you buy some popcorn and soda, a night at the movies is very expensive and easily costs 10x more than renting the movie. You just have to learn to wait for the movie to come out on video!
